All streams
Search
Write a publication
Pull to refresh
54
0.7
Михаил Кнутарев @mmMike

User

Send message

Ну я из своего опыта первых экспериментов и попыток построить летающую платформу
Фраза


Пока не было надежной электроники для согласования моторов, смотреть на полеты таких устройств жутковато. Здесь были и поломанные рамы, и потерянные видеокамеры, и утонувшие в водоемах дорогостоящие электронные модули.

Близка к моему опыту, но не раскрывает деталей. Вот как раз когда появились на ebay первые интегральные гироскопы — только тогда и начало что то получатся (у меня, как минимум).
Вот даже один в руках верчу как раз сейчас. Платка с IDG300A и ATMega. Уже как "память" не более.
К сожалению (а может и нет) сейчас уже DIY для дронов — смысла не имеет. На поток дроны и их ПО поставлены.

Странно, что совсем не упоминается ключевой фактор — появление дешевых гироскопов и контроллеров. Вертолет с коллекторным двигателем — да легко. Были такие, да и сейчас есть.


А вот вручную управлять полетом квадрокоптера (полностью вручную без контроллера и гироскопа) — просто не реально.

Мне кажется или всю статью можно было свести к одной фразе:
"Гляньте на пакет org.springframework.statemachine и не изобретайте велосипед, если вам вдруг он понадобился".
Извините, но… IMHO, официальная документация на этот пакет понятнее.

Что на ваш взгляд перспективнее (популярнее), -M3 или -A53?

M3 — это ядро для контроллеров.
А53 — это "большие процессоры"


Вопрос звучит так (если перефразировать и отпрыгнуть на 15 лет назад): "Что перспективнее/популярнее Atmel 8-битные контроллеры или x486 процессоры"

ARM Cortex M3/M4 — это ядра для контроллеров.
Оно все же отличается от raspberry (Cortex-A53) и сильно.


Но мой взгляд, ничего сложного в том, что бы разобраться со спецификацией, скажем на STM32F103 — нет. Полно информации/примеров и пр.

Где брать IDE (и какую именно), как ее настроить, чем прошивать, да еще разобраться в регистрах и настройках контроллера.

С ходу прямо здесь https://habr.com/ru/post/310742/
https://habr.com/ru/search/?q=%5Bstm32%5D&target_type=posts


А эти ваши ARM все разные. Захочешь перейти на другой контроллер — заново изучай все 100500 миллионов регистров)

С учетом того, что купить проще всего продукцию STM, то лучше смотреть на нее.
А архитектура… Ядро ARM Cortex M3 или M4 как раз и предполагает стандарт.


Самая дешевая плата stm32f103c8t6 стоит копейки.

Основной аргумент поклонников Atmel 8-бит: )
"Оно же работает!"
Мда… STM32F102 младшенькие…
АЦП 12 бит 1 Msps 2 канала vs 10 бит ATMega
тактовая частота… DMA… таймеры на любой вкус… память ОЗУ и Флеш..


Скажите просто "лень изучать": )


В сравнивать с процами 80-х годов это даже смешно.

Время работы — 4 часа — вполне неплохо IMHO. Как сказал когда-то один товарищ — в DIY ты делаешь для себя, а узнавать чьи-то оценки и т.п. — совершенно лишнее.

Совершенно не достаточно. Познал сам на практике, когда поехал на коп со своим прибором для проверки в полевых условиях. (комары, жара… грязь и еще аккумуляторы не вовремя закончились… бр..)


а и АЦП с таким усилением легко перегружается

Решается наличием операционников до АЦП с программным коэф. усиления (в цепи обратной связи аналоговый многоканальный мультиплексор) и подстройкой КУ прямо по сигналу.


АЦП ATmega328

Всегда удивляюсь… А не тесно?
Что мешает использовать современные ARM Cortex m3/m3 контроллеры, вместо древнючих медленных Atmel 8-ми битников..

Сам таким увлекался. До сих пор в углу стоит металлоискатель самодельный с прямой оцифровкой сигнала.
Только это не удачное направление. По причинам:


  • Визуализация на экране — очень не практично (экран при ярком освещении плохо читаем; при поиске в экран пялится очень не удобно).
  • Для нейросети нужно собрать огромную обучающую базу. Мало того что это очень трудоемко, так и еще это будет база под конкретную катушку. А уж как легкий дождик и мокрая трава влияют на параметры сигнала! Не реально.
  • На количество акумуляторов и время работы (часа на 4 хватает) мне копатели сказали "фии.."

В общем сферический конь в вакуме. На которого я когда то потратил кучу времени.
Селекция мозгом по слуху у опытного поисковика дает гораздо лучшей результат.
За последние 10 лет в металлоискателях особого прогресса нет.

GitHub — хостинг репозиториев.

Для военных?! Хостинг исходного кода на внешних ресурсах?!
Даже не поверил. Залез в исходный текст и офигел. Действительно. Есть такая рекомендация


BitBucket or GitHub — repository hosting sites.

Ну просто что бы поболтать (жду ответа на письмо..).


А что такое тогда "Unix" в частом виде?
На примере.

Ну вообще да, Unix != Linux

Ну зависит от точки зрения. Формально (ядро, файловая система и пр.) и так. А с точки зрения разработки ПО… исходники прикладного ПО на C++ под различные клоны Linux, BSD, AIX, Solaris фактически одни и те же (мелкие особенности API конкретного варианта). С этой точки зрения, для меня это "Unix подобные OS".


однако отваливаются коммерческие версии.

И да… слухи о смерти, например, Solaris для корпоративного и банковского сектора несколько преувеличены.

Начиная с 1970-х годов от IT-индустрии постоянно откалываются обломки устаревших технологий: мейнфреймы, VAX, Unix, Cobol и т. д.

Unix в одном списке c Cobol…
Аа! для автора Unix и Linux наверное разное.

А насколько типичный термоклин на 6 метрах (с 15 до 5 градусов перепада) может повлиять на связь?
И какая максимальная рабочая глубина ваших модемов?


Относительно недавно был свидетелем гибели двух дайверов. И глубина вроде бы не предельная..(на 31..35 метрах все произошло). Судя по всему (по расположению тел) потеряли друг друга, стали активно искать друг друга и и… азотка накрыла.
Конечно такой модем не панацея, но лучше какой то способ связи чем никакой в таких случаях.

Когда то очень давно (2005-2006) было увлечение UML. Предлагалась как панацея и ответ на "The Ultimate Question of Life, the Universe, and Everything".


До сих пор помню (такое не забыть) пример использования UML в бизнесе из книги (доке кажется) от Rational Software (Rational Rose).


Содержание примера (почти дословно):


Жила была семья со своим мелким бизнесом. И что что то у них не шло с бизнесом. Прочитали они учебник по UML. Купили продует Rational Rose. Нарисовали в нем диаграмму (картинка диаграммы сценариев использования на 5-6 объектов со стрелочками) и тут у них КАК ПОПЕРЛО в бизнесе!


После прочтения этой главы у меня закралось подозрение… а не дурят ли меня.
Как показало время, подозрение было обоснованным.

Не очень понятно..


на мошенничеств с использованием бесконтактных технологий нам не грозит. Мерчанты уже предприняли дополнительные меры защиты

И тут же статья переключается на другое. И причем здесь то, как банк регистрирует merchant и какие у него административные процедуры для этого.
И как обычный продавец может определить что конкретно "прислонили" к ридеру терминала?


Единственная защита "порядочный человек из за мелкой выгоды большой пакости не сделает"


Ну и порог вхождения.
Мелкий гопник (два минимум) из за 1000 руб должен уметь собрать android приложение, иметь свой VPS что бы не в пределах прямой видимости хотя бы работал (не локальный WiFi между телефонами)…
Да проще мелочь по карманам тырить!


Ссылку на Github на приложение не даю. кому интересно — найдут. Ничего в этом сложно в организации bridge по TCP/IP между двумя NFC телефонами один из которых как ридер работает, а другой как "карта".


Вот когда банкоматы начнут выдавать нал по бесконтакту… Вот тут то волна и пойдет.
Посмотреть PIN не сложно. А нал это не товар на 1000 руб.

Это лучше чем "китайский мальчик продал почку за айпад".
Хотя тем кто берет телефон (!) в лизинг нужно голову лечить…
Это каких же размеров тараканов занесенных рекламой нужно иметь в башке, что бы так "мечтать" о "телефоне последнего поколения".

Потому что motion detect — это совершенно не зависимо от поездить с FPV

Как шумит румба без включенного пылесоса — не слышал. А с пылесосом она безобразно шумная.


Моторы, поскольку с редуктором, то жужжат. но не слишком громко. В соседней комнате уже не слышно.


Автономная зарядка? Это как?
я планирую перед отпуском просто два контакта на корпус вывести и подгонять к ним, когда уровень заряда упадет. А так почти на неделю хватает автонома… За ночь заряжается.

Information

Rating
1,823-rd
Location
Новосибирск, Новосибирская обл., Россия
Date of birth
Registered
Activity